Job Overview
The Data Solutions Lead II is responsible for evaluating the most complex and elevated business requests, determining the appropriate solution path, and leading high-impact enhanced analytical or innovation-led efforts that extend beyond standard data product delivery. This role translates ambiguous business problems into structured, actionable solution strategies, aligns stakeholders across functions, and ensures complex work is led effectively from framing through delivery.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Evaluate highly complex, ambiguous, and cross-functional business requests and determine the most appropriate solution path
- Define strategic business logic, KPIs, measures, and structured solution approaches for high-impact enhanced analytical or innovation-led efforts
- Lead and coordinate the most complex enhanced analytical or innovation-led solutions in partnership with business stakeholders and technical resources
- Influence stakeholders, drive alignment, and manage tradeoffs across competing priorities, solution options, and business outcomes
- Route standard output work back to Data Product Developers when requests can be addressed through established delivery patterns
- Document solution approaches, requirements, key decisions, and logic to support execution, continuity, and scalable reuse
- Other duties as assigned
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ities
- Deep ability to translate highly ambiguous business needs into structured solution strategies
- Strong experience defining KPIs, measures, decision frameworks, business logic, and end-to-end solution approaches
- Strong judgment in determining whether work should remain standard, move to enhanced analytics, or require innovation-led development
- Advanced facilitation, communication, and stakeholder influence skills
- Ability to lead complex cross-functional efforts without formal authority
- Strong understanding of reporting, dashboards, data products, automation, advanced analytics, and innovation-led solution models
- Ability to manage tradeoffs across business value, scalability, timing, and solution practicality\
- Experience leading high-visibility initiatives or strategic solution work
Minimum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ree (4 years)
- 7 or more years
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Business Analytics, Information Systems, Computer Science, Data Analytics, Business Administration, or a related field is preferred.
